Signs That You May Need To Replace Your Bathtub

How often do you think about your bathtub? Most of us give it a good cleaning every now and then, especially when company is coming to visit. However, when was the last time you thought about getting a new tub for your bathroom or performing any significant remodeling to your bathroom? Here are a few signs that you may need to replace your bathtub and how doing so can prevent long-term damage to your home.

Noticeable Cracks

One of the common things to watch out for is cracks or chips in your bathtub’s foundation. Differences in the water temperature versus your home’s temperature can lead to some damage. Smaller cracks are fixable with kits and sandpaper, but they’re not always the best long-term solution. If you’re tired of repairing these minor imperfections, it may be time to consider investing in a new tub.

Active Leaks

The largest sign that you may need to replace your bathtub is when you notice major leaks. Some leaks are much more noticeable since they pool onto your bathroom floor, but others may get into your wall, which can cause mold and mildew. If your tub is leaking and you can’t fix it with simple caulking, it’s a good idea to look into these steps to replace your bathtub.

Stubborn Stains

Not every sign that it’s time for a new tub may result in extensive problems that can damage your house or fill it with the foul odor of mold. Sometimes your once pristine white tub starts to show its age, and you may notice discoloration, fading, a gross yellow-ish tint, and some stubborn stains that won’t come out no matter what you do. It may not be the most damaging sign, but tub stains are not aesthetically pleasing and may be the first thing that makes you consider a replacement.
